A window popped up in the lower right corner of my server informing me:

SSL
An error was encountered with the SSL certificate.

The only way to remove the window is to reboot. I have found nothing in the forum or search engines to help find out why I am suddenly encountering this error and how to fix it.

What gives?

Hi FSSBIT - this is a new tray notification that was added during our last release. It shows when a machine is missing some SSL certificates that our agent needs.

The resolution should be a simple reinstall of the agent. Could you please DM me the computer name?

Also if you could you please submit a diagnostic report? To do this:

  1. Right-click the CCleaner Cloud icon in the system tray, near the clock and select 'Preferences' this will open the CCleaner Cloud Preferences window
  2. In the 'Preferences' window, navigate to the 'Debug' tab
  3. Look at the section that says 'Logging' and click "Submit" for Diagnostic Report
  4. In the "Issue Description" box, please put "For Support" and press "OK" to submit the report.
